Artificial Intelligence (AI) is rapidly reshaping business operations, and human resources (HR) is no exception. As companies work to harness AI to boost workforce efficiency and improve decision making, HR professionals must gain a deep understanding of AI’s potential and its applications. This Mastering Artificial Intelligence (AI) for HR Professionals training course designed specifically for HR practitioners, provides the knowledge and tools necessary to excel in an AI-driven environment.
AI offers new opportunities for HR professionals, from automating routine tasks to gaining more comprehensive insights into employee
performance and engagement. This Mastering Artificial Intelligence (AI) for HR Professionals training course aims to bridge the gap
between traditional HR methods and advanced AI technologies, empowering participants to drive innovation and create meaningful
change within their organizations.
A. Introduction to Artificial Intelligence in Administration and Management
1. Morning Session
- What is AI? Understanding AI, ML, NLP, and automation
- Key trends: AI in the workplace and its impact on administration
- The evolving role of administrators and managers in the age of AI
2. Afternoon Session
- Case studies: How AI is being used in HR, finance, logistics, and office management
- Tools overview: Microsoft Copilot, ChatGPT, Google Workspace AI, Power BI, and more
- Activity: AI-readiness self-assessment for your organisation.
B. AI for Communication, Document & Task Management
1. Morning Session
- Automating email responses and calendar scheduling with AI
- Generating professional documents, letters, and reports using AI
2. Afternoon Session
- Summarising meeting notes and creating action plans with AI tools
- Introduction to AI-based task management and virtual assistants (e.g., Microsoft Copilot, Notion AI, Google Duet)
- Activity: Practice session using AI tools to manage admin task
C. AI for Communication, Document & Task Management
1. Morning Session
- Basics of data analysis for non-technical professional
- Using AI for data cleaning, visualisation, and insights (Power BI,
Excel AI, Google Sheets AI
2. Afternoon Session
- Building simple dashboards and automated report
- AI-powered decision-making: using insights to support planning and policy
- Activity: Creating a report or dashboard using AI tools
D. AI for Workflow Automation and Process Efficiency
1. Morning Session
- Introduction to process automation with AI
- Using tools like Microsoft Power Automate and Zapier to streamline workflows
2. Afternoon Session
- Automating document approvals, notifications, reminders, and form responses
- Integrating AI into HR, procurement, and records management processes
- Activity: Designing a simple automated workflow
E. Ethics, Implementation Planning, and Practical Simulation
1. Morning Session
- Ethical use of AI in administration (bias, privacy, transparency
- AI policy, compliance, and risk management
2. Afternoon Session
- Implementation roadmap: planning AI integration in your
department - Capstone simulation: Use AI tools to complete a management task from start to finish
- Activity: Present group action plans for AI adoption in your organization
